Java文件获取文件路径的实现

一、流程图

使用以下表格展示整个获取文件路径的流程:

步骤 描述
1 创建一个Java项目
2 导入所需的包
3 获取文件路径
4 处理获取到的文件路径

二、具体步骤

步骤1:创建一个Java项目

首先,你需要创建一个Java项目来实现获取文件路径的功能。你可以使用任何IDE,如Eclipse或IntelliJ IDEA来创建项目。

步骤2:导入所需的包

在Java项目中,我们需要导入一些类来实现获取文件路径的功能。我们需要导入以下包:

import java.io.File;

步骤3:获取文件路径

在Java中,我们可以使用File类来获取文件路径。以下是一个示例代码,用于获取文件路径:

File file = new File("path/to/file.txt");
String filePath = file.getAbsolutePath();

代码解释:

  • 首先,我们创建一个File对象,其中参数是文件的路径。
  • 然后,我们使用getAbsolutePath()方法来获取文件的绝对路径,并将其赋值给filePath变量。

步骤4:处理获取到的文件路径

获取到文件路径后,你可以根据实际需求对其进行处理。以下是一个示例代码,用于展示获取到的文件路径:

System.out.println("File Path: " + filePath);

代码解释:

  • 我们使用System.out.println()方法将获取到的文件路径输出到控制台。

三、类图

下面是一个简单的类图,展示了在获取文件路径过程中涉及的类及其关系:

classDiagram
    class File {
        +File(String path)
        +getAbsolutePath():String
    }

类图解释:

  • 我们使用File类来表示文件对象。
  • File类有一个构造函数,参数为文件路径。
  • File类有一个方法getAbsolutePath(),用于获取文件的绝对路径。

四、序列图

下面是一个简单的序列图,展示了获取文件路径的过程:

sequenceDiagram
    participant Developer
    participant Newbie
    Developer->>Newbie: 教授获取文件路径的方法
    opt 创建File对象
        Newbie->>File: File file = new File("path/to/file.txt");
    end
    opt 获取文件路径
        Newbie->>File: String filePath = file.getAbsolutePath();
    end
    Developer->>Newbie: 处理获取到的文件路径
    Newbie->>Developer: 输出文件路径

序列图解释:

  • 开发者教授获取文件路径的方法。
  • 新手创建一个File对象来表示文件。
  • 新手使用File对象的getAbsolutePath()方法来获取文件的绝对路径。
  • 开发者处理获取到的文件路径。
  • 新手将文件路径输出。

五、总结

通过上述步骤,你可以成功实现在Java中获取文件路径的功能。首先,你需要创建一个Java项目,并导入所需的包。然后,使用File类来获取文件路径,并根据需要处理获取到的文件路径。

希望这篇文章对你有帮助!